On that note, I would say it's Garrus's POPULARITY that took him out of the running for a same-sex romance. Bioware likely saw that he was popular with both the ladies AND the dudebros (rare), and decided that to change him AT ALL would be an unnecessary risk. He's at the height of his popularity, if they did something to his character, fairly certain the dudebro-fanboy fallout would be fierce. You may argue it wouldn't be a "change" to his PERSONALITY, but it would be revealing a new and sadly risky detail about him. Plus, there wasn't as large an outcry for an m/m Garrusmance as there was for m/m Kaidan or f/f Ash. Personally, I do think it was the safest move for them, fanbase-wise. A lot of guys can't take the idea that their bro would sleep with them if he had the chance, and... Garrus is known as a bro. If he wasn't as popular across the board as he is, I think they might have offered him m/m. As it is, it was far safer to leave him alone and focus on making characters people ALREADY argue about same-sex compatible.
We also have to understand that making a character available to both genders IS more work, especially with the amount of romances present in ME3. They can't make it happen for everyone. They need to record extra dialogue for femShep or manShep, adjust the animations appropriately, etc., and ME3 is going to be massive enough as it is. Hopefully we can appreciate the options we HAVE been given, especially since it's a first for a Mass Effect game. And considering this is the first time we'll have gay-only and lesbian-only romance options (if those are actually in the game), I think that's a step forward in terms of orientation-equality.
